Lantern data study

The 25 worst-staffed nursing homes in Texas.

Nurse staffing is the strongest predictor of a home's safety — and the number referral sites rarely show. We ranked every rated Texas home by nurse hours per resident.

Read the study
FacilityNurse hrs/dayOverall
Houston County Nursing Home · Crockett1.98★★★★
Premier Health Care Center · Ranger2.21
South Dallas Nursing & Rehabilitation · Dallas2.23
San Saba Nursing & Rehabilitation · San Saba2.26★★★★★

Source: CMS Care Compare (Nursing Homes), dataset 4pq5-n9py, retrieved 2026-08-09. Median Texas home: 3.27 hrs.

How we're funded

We take no money from any care facility. Ever.

Most senior-care sites are paid thousands each time they place your parent, so they hide the safety records of the homes that pay them. We don't. No facility can pay to be listed, ranked, or hidden.

Every number comes from public CMS data, with the source and date shown on the page.

We fund the site through clearly-labeled product recommendations and our own plain-English planning guides — never facility placements.
